'March of Reform', 1833. William Cobbett; John Wilson Croker; John Gully; Joseph Pease; Edward Burtenshaw Sugden, 1st Baron St Leonards; Horace Twiss; Sir Charles Wetherell; Francis Williams. Satirical cartoon on British politics by '' (John Doyle). [Thomas McLean, London, 1833]
